pkg/domain/infra/abi: add getContainers
Add a new `getContainers` function to consolidate listing and looking up containers. An options struct keeps thing flexible and makes callers more readable. [NO NEW TESTS NEEDED] as it shouldn't change behavior. Signed-off-by: Valentin Rothberg <vrothberg@redhat.com>
